andorczyk
See also: Andorczyk
Polish
Etymology
From Andora + -czyk. Compare Québécois, Québécoise (female) (“a native or inhabitant of the province or city of Quebec”).
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/anˈdɔr.t͡ʂɨk/
Audio (file) - Rhymes: -ɔrt͡ʂɨk
- Syllabification: an‧dor‧czyk
Noun
andorczyk m pers (feminine andorka)
- Andorran (an inhabitant of Andorra la Vella, the capital city of the country of Andorra)
Declension
Declension of andorczyk
| singular | plural | |
|---|---|---|
| nominative | andorczyk | andorczycy |
| genitive | andorczyka | andorczyków |
| dative | andorczykowi | andorczykom |
| accusative | andorczyka | andorczyków |
| instrumental | andorczykiem | andorczykami |
| locative | andorczyku | andorczykach |
| vocative | andorczyku | andorczycy |
